Helping seedlings

Do you guys and gals help seedlings? Or is it survival of the fittest in your seedtrays?

I help seedlings' roots by covering them with soil when they seem to need help and remove seed coats when seedlings seem to have a hard time shedding them.

Re: Poaching......Conophytum burgeri

Very sad.
This underlines once more every collector's responsibility to only buy from reputable sources and never pay high prices for a specimen of a rare species. High prices paid are perverse incentives for illegal collectors.
